[TOP STORY] Don’t cancel your medical aid, NHI a way off yet

Loading player...
‘There is a host of different elements that the government will have to address and basically ensure that they're put in place before any change can take place to the private healthcare that a number of South Africans have at the moment,’ says Gary Feldman, executive head of Healthcare Consulting at NMG Benefits.
